Referring to fig. 1 to 5, the invention provides a decoration engineering indoor design effect display system 100, where the decoration engineering indoor design effect display system 100 includes a fixed seat 1, a push component 2, a mounting plate 3, a shock-absorbing component 4, a display stand 5 and a light-supplementing component 6, the push component 2 is fixedly connected with the fixed seat 1 and embedded in the fixed seat 1, the push component 2 is provided with the mounting plate 3, the number of the shock-absorbing components 4 is multiple, each group of the shock-absorbing components 4 is respectively fixedly connected with the mounting plate 3, the number of the light-supplementing components 6 is multiple, and each group of the light-supplementing components 6 is respectively fixedly connected with the fixed seat 1 and is located above the fixed seat 1;

In this embodiment, the design effect display picture is fixed on the display stand 5, when a customer visits the design effect display picture, the light supplement component 6 is controlled to operate, the light supplement component 6 illuminates the design effect display picture to increase the visual definition of the customer, in order to improve the display effect of the design effect display picture, the pushing component 2 is controlled to operate according to the height of the customer, the pushing component 2 drives the mounting plate 3 to move up and down to drive the display stand 5 to move up and down so as to adapt to the height of the customer, in the process of operating the pushing component 2, the mounting plate 3 moves, the display stand 5 is vibrated, at the moment, the damping spring 43 absorbs the vibration received by the display stand 5, the design effect display stand 5 is prevented from shaking along with the vibration of the display stand 5, and the display effect of the design effect display picture is improved, one end of the inner rod 42 is in sliding connection with the outer cylinder 41, the outer cylinder 41 is in cooperation with the inner rod 42, the stability of the damping spring 43 is improved, and after a customer visits, the light supplementing assembly 6 stops operating, the display is finished, and the display effect of the design effect display diagram is improved.
Further, the damping assembly 4 further includes a limiting block 44, the outer cylinder 41 is provided with a limiting groove 411, and the limiting block 44 is fixedly connected with the outer cylinder 41 and is located in the limiting groove 411.
In this embodiment, the stopper 44 is located in the stopper groove 411 to prevent the inner rod 42 from falling off from the outer cylinder 41, thereby reducing the stability of the damper spring 43.
Further, the pushing assembly 2 comprises an air cylinder 21 and a push rod 22, the air cylinder 21 is fixedly connected with the fixed seat 1 and is embedded in the fixed seat 1, and one end of the push rod 22 is fixedly connected with an output end of the air cylinder 21.
In this embodiment, in order to improve the display effect of the design effect display diagram, the operation of the cylinder 21 can be controlled according to the height of the customer, the cylinder 21 is matched with the push rod 22 to drive the mounting plate 3 to move up and down, and the display stand 5 is driven to move up and down so as to adapt to the height of the customer.
Further, the light supplementing assembly 6 includes a support rod 61 and a lighting lamp 62, one end of the support rod 61 is fixedly connected to the fixing base 1, and the lighting lamp 62 is fixedly connected to the other end of the support rod 61.
In this embodiment, the support rod 61 supports the illuminating lamp 62, and the illuminating lamp 62 operates to illuminate the design effect display drawing, thereby increasing the visual clarity of the customer.
Further, the light supplementing assembly 6 further comprises a gathering cover 63, and the gathering cover 63 is fixedly connected with the support rod 61 and wraps the illuminating lamp 62.
In this embodiment, the focusing cover 63 focuses the light beam of the illuminating lamp 62 on the design effect display drawing, thereby increasing the visual clarity of the customer.
Further, the decoration engineering indoor design effect display system 100 further includes a friction pad 7, and the friction pad 7 is fixedly connected to the fixing base 1 and is located below the fixing base 1.
In this embodiment, the friction pad 7 increases the friction between the fixing base 1 and the ground, so as to prevent the fixing base 1 from deviating from the ground.
Further, the decoration engineering indoor design effect display system 100 further includes a rotating assembly 8, a connecting rod 9, a rotating shaft 101, a semicircular block 102, a friction block 103 and a pulling block 104, the rotating assembly 8 is fixedly connected with the output end of the push rod 22, one end of the connecting rod 9 is fixedly connected with the rotating assembly 8, the rotating shaft 101 is fixedly connected with the other end of the connecting rod 9, the semicircular block 102 is fixedly connected with the mounting plate 3, the rotating shaft 101 penetrates through the semicircular block 102, the friction block 103 is fixedly connected with the semicircular block 102 and is attached to the rotating shaft 101, the number of the pulling blocks is two, and each pulling block 104 is fixedly connected with the mounting plate 3 and is located on the outer side wall of the mounting plate 3.
In this embodiment, a customer may control the rotation assembly 8 to operate, the rotation assembly 8 drives the connection rod 9 to rotate, so as to drive the display stand 5 to rotate, when the customer needs to adjust the angle of the display stand 5, the customer holds the pulling block 104 and applies force, and under the cooperation of the rotation shaft 101, the semicircular block 102 is enabled to deviate from the connection rod 9 by an angle, and the friction block 103 increases friction on the semicircular block 102, so that the semicircular block 102 fixes the angle, thereby achieving an effect of improving the display effect of the design effect display diagram.
Further, the rotating assembly 8 comprises a rotating motor 81 and a speed reducer 82, the rotating motor 81 is fixedly connected with the output end of the push rod 22, the speed reducer 82 is fixedly connected with the output end of the rotating motor 81, and one end of the connecting rod 9 is fixedly connected with the output end of the speed reducer 82.
In this embodiment, the customer controls the operation of the rotating motor 81, the rotating motor 81 is matched with the speed reducer 82 to drive the connecting rod 9 to rotate, so as to drive the display stand 5 to rotate, thereby realizing the improvement of the display effect of the design effect display diagram.
Referring to fig. 6, the present invention further provides a display method using the decoration engineering indoor design effect display system 100, including the following steps:
s1: fixing the design effect display drawing on the display stand 5, controlling the light supplementing assembly 6 to operate, and illuminating the design effect display drawing by the light supplementing assembly 6;
s2: controlling the pushing assembly 2 to operate according to the height of a customer, wherein the pushing assembly 2 drives the mounting plate 3 to move until the customer can visit the whole design effect display diagram;
s3: stopping the operation of the pushing assembly 2, so that the customer visits the whole design effect display diagram;
s4: and stopping the operation of the light supplementing assembly 6, and finishing the display.
